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
Tags
- 시스템해킹
- 콜리젼 도메인
- 코드엔진 basic 5
- 치트엔진 풀이
- code engine
- 데지그네이티드 포트
- 코드엔진 풀이
- BPDU
- TCP/IP
- 루핑
- 링크 대역폭
- 서브넷
- Path Cost
- ip주소
- 코드엔진
- 네트워크
- 스패닝 트리 알고리즘
- 루트 브리지
- 루트 포트
- 서브넷 마스크
- 브리지 우선순위
- code enigne
- 서브넷팅
- 네트워크 장비
- 해커스쿨 FTZ
- Root Bridge
- FTZ level3
- 세그먼트
- Non Root Bridge
- 브리지 ID
Archives
- Today
- Total
IT 블로그 !!
브리지/스위치 기능 본문
Learning, Flooding, Forwarding, Filtering, Aging.
5가지의 일을 수행한다.
Learning.
출발지의 맥 어드레스를 배운다.
브리지/스위치는 포트에 연결된 PC "A"가 통신을 위해 프레임을 내보내면
그때 이 PC의 MAC 주소를 읽어서 자신의 맥 어드레스 테이블(브리지 테이블)에 저장한다.
[맥 어드레스 테이블(브리지 테이블): 스위치나 브리지에 연결된 사용자들의 맥 주소를 저장하는 데이터베이스]
Flooding.
들어온 포트를 제외한 나머지를 모든 포트로 데이터를 뿌린다.
PC "A"가 통신하고자 하는 목적지 PC의 맥 주소가 브리지 테이블에 없으면
모든 포트에 데이터를 전송한다. (브로드캐스트 라고 생각해도 됨. 브로드캐스트도 Flooding이 발생함)
Forwarding
Flooding과 반대로 목적지 PC의 맥 주소를 알고 그 목적지가 브릿지를 건너야 할때
오직 그 해당 포트쪽으로만 데이터를 전송한다.
Filtering
브릿지를 넘어가지 못하게 막는것.
출발지와 목적지가 같은 세그먼트에 있을때 일어남.
[세그먼트: 브릿지, 라우터, 허브 또는 스위치에 의해 묶어있는 네트워크의 한 부분]
이 Filtering 기능 때문에 허브와 다르게 콜리젼 도메인을 나눌 수 있다.
Aging
브리지 테이블에 출발지의 MAC 주소가 들어오면 300초 동안 타이머를 설정한다.
300초가 지나도록 다시 그 출발지 주소의 프레임이 들어오지 않으면 브리지 테이블에서 삭제한다.
'네트워크' 카테고리의 다른 글
스패닝 트리 알고리즘(Spanning Tree Algorithm) (0) | 2020.02.03 |
---|---|
루핑(Looping) (0) | 2020.01.31 |
브리지/스위치 (0) | 2020.01.30 |
허브 (0) | 2020.01.30 |
네트워크 장비 - 랜카드 (0) | 2020.01.30 |